One of my dwarves is wearing a bloodsteel breastplate with the following runes:
bronze (no pain) 
copper (no nausea) 
wolfram (no stun) 
mithril (no exert) 
chrome (nosleep)
cobalt (underwater breathing)
titanium (no paralysis) 
 
She ended up with a fractured thigh after a fight plus some bruises and there's no mention of pain, so I think the bronze rune is working. This is her first time on the surface and there's the unhappy thought of being nauseated by the sun but no actual nausea/vomiting so I think the copper is working properly. 
 
She still got stunned when colliding with enemies/objects and is currently listed as tired, am I misunderstanding what the wolfram and mithril runes do or are they just not working due to a bug?

General reminder for the Summer skill change, CCP is in Iceland. Their summer starts in April, not June like it does for some of us.

We don't know yet exactly when during summer the changes will arrive, but those planning to complete skill training plans before the changes might potentially have as few as 32 days to finish it. Some skills, like Battlecruisers and Destroyers, will be duplicated to racials even with partial training. For example, if you're only 50% to BC 5, you'll get 50% to each racial Battlecruiser skill when the change happens. Incomplete training is not a total loss. For some changes though, like injecting Command Ships skill to avoid the additional 40 days of training prerequisites being added, it is necessary to reach training targets to get any benefit from them.

Due diligence is advised.
